AP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

写h5生成app

H5生成APP是一种将H5网页打包成原生APP进行发布的方法,它的原理是在一个原生的壳子(Native Shell)中嵌入一个H5页面。在这个壳子中,内置了一个可以解析WebView的应用引擎。而在应用引擎中载入的就是H5的网页文件。这种方法既可以在安卓平台上使用,也可以在IOS平台上使用,而且兼容性非常好,而且开发成本相对较低,因此越来越多的APP开始采用这种技术。下面我们通过以下几个方面来介绍H5生成APP。

一、如何进行H5打包

在完成H5开发和设计工作后,需要把代码和资源文件打包成一个APP。目前,常见的打包工具有以下几种:

1. PhoneGap

PhoneGap是一个按照HTML5规范来进行开发移动应用的开源平台。PhoneGap可以将H5页面打包成原生APP,只需使用HTML5、CSS3、JavaScript等前端技术即可开发出Android、iOS、Windows phone等多个终端的原生应用。

2. Cordova

Cordova也是一个可以将H5页面打包成原生APP的打包工具。Cordova的H5页面可以使用JavaScript、CSS等前端技术,然后再根据需要在框架的基础上用实现原生的插件将一些底层的操作和服务如传感器、网络、设备信息、文件系统和SQLite等操作欲加以整合。

3. HBuilder

HBuilder是国内比较流行的一款集成开发环境。除了可用于对H5网页进行编辑和开发,同时也可用于打包,生成各个平台的APK文件。该工具的使用非常方便,只需创建项目,按照提示操作即可生成相应APK文件。

4. Flyme SDK

Flyme SDK也是一款可用于原生APP打包的工具。该工具适用于开发者在Flyme平台上开发一款基于H5技术的原生APP。

以上是目前比较常见的H5打包工具,选择合适的工具可以大大提高打包的效率,同时也可以提高你的工作效率,使你更专注于你所能够擅长的内容和你感兴趣的内容。

二、如何优化H5生成APP

良好的用户体验是一个APP的成功关键,在进行H5生成APP的过程中也需要考虑如何优化APP的用户体验。下面是一些优化建议:

1. 清晰的导航和界面设计,使页面能够准确的呈现和发布内容。

2. 确保页面的流畅度和稳定性,这将有效的提高用户体验度。

3. 对于操作或者交互的页面元素,需要做好响应式设计和交互式设计。

4. 在页面中合理放置广告,不要影响用户的体验。

5. 页面的响应速度不要太慢,尽可能的进行优化处理,提供快速、流畅、用户友好的页面体验。

三、H5生成APP的优点

1. 节约开发成本:开发者可以基于已有的H5网站进行APP的开发,从而大大降低开发成本。

2. 提高APP的兼容性:由于基于HTML5规范开发,因此可以快速、简单地完成多平台打包和发布。

3. 便于维护:当网站升级或者遇到问题时,可以很方便地对APP进行更新。

4. 允许复用现有的模块:这将降低开发的成本且减少在开发APP时需要解决的问题。

5. 灵活性强:开发人员可以根据网站的需求将模块进行调整和拓展。

总结:

H5生成APP是一种基于HTML5的技术,可以快速、简单的打包并发布到多个平台上,具有非常好的用户体验。H5生成APP已经成为了移动应用领域的新趋势,开发者可以基于现有H5网站快速进行移动应用开发,提高工作效率并且节约开发成本。


相关知识:
做h5好用的app
H5(HTML5)成为了移动端web应用的一种重要技术方案,同时也被广大开发者和企业所接受。在实际的应用场景中,一个好用的H5 app通常需要具备以下几个方面的特点:一、界面交互设计美观易用好的app界面设计能够吸引用户的眼球,让用户产生使用欲望。同时界面
2023-05-26
做h5的app
H5(Hyper Text Markup Language 5)是一种用于构建Web页面和应用程序的标准语言。而H5的App则是一种在移动设备上基于H5技术开发的应用程序,是一种轻量级的应用,不需要下载安装,可以直接在手机浏览器中打开使用。H5的App采用
2023-05-26
为什么现在app都用h5开发
H5(HTML5)作为一种新一代的Web标准技术,在移动互联网时代逐渐成为了Web开发的主流技术,并在移动应用领域得到了广泛应用。目前已经有许多App使用H5技术进行开发,其主要原因在于以下几个方面。1.跨平台性强H5技术开发的应用具有跨平台性,即同一份代
2023-05-26
如何把h5网友做成原生app
想要将 H5 网页端应用转换为原生 App,我们需要使用一些工具或框架来实现。下面就为大家介绍一下具体的方法。一、Hybrid App 技术Hybrid App 技术就是将原生的App与 H5 网页端结合起来,通过设置 WebView 的容器,在上面加载
2023-05-26
免费h5页面制作软件app
近年来,随着互联网技术和移动设备的发展,H5页面逐渐成为互联网应用开发的重要基础。而为了更好地满足市场需求,一些厂商推出了免费的H5页面制作软件,方便用户快速制作H5页面。下面本文将为大家介绍几款免费的H5页面制作软件。1. MagicHTMLMagicH
2023-05-26
混合app开发h5交互
混合app开发是目前比较流行的一种移动应用开发方式。与传统的原生应用开发方式不同,混合开发可以使用跨平台的技术开发出同时适用于多个操作系统的应用程序。同时,混合开发还涉及到一些基于H5技术的交互方式。1. 混合开发的原理混合开发的原理是将网页内容嵌入到原生
2023-05-25
封装h5成app
封装h5成app即将网页或者网站打包封装成一个原生APP应用程序,让用户可以在手机上更方便地使用。这是一种非常流行的方法,因为HTML、CSS和JavaScript等网络技术使得开发人员能够快速开发响应式的、适应不同设备的网站或应用程序。本文将详细介绍如何
2023-05-25
h5制作软件的app
H5制作软件的APP,是一种基于H5技术的APP制作工具,专门用来制作移动应用程序。H5是指“HTML5”,它是一种开放的标准化的Web技术,是一种可用于创建响应式网站和移动应用的最新版本的HTML代码。H5制作软件的APP,通常具有简单易用、快速开发、复
2023-05-25
h5模式的app定制开发
H5模式的APP是指采用H5技术编写的App,其核心是使用webview作为容器,将H5页面嵌入其中,在实现APP的基本功能的同时,实现了HTML5的各种功能和交互特效。H5模式的APP在开发过程中,相较于Native App便捷快速,具有更好的兼容性,更
2023-05-25
h5开发体验性为何不如原生app
HTML5开发虽然被广泛认为是一种跨平台、节约成本的高效开发方式,但在体验方面却远远无法与原生APP相比。原生APP在用户交互、流畅度、速度感等方面都有明显优势,而HTML5在这些方面则存在着不小的缺陷。下面我们就来逐一分析HTML5开发体验不如原生APP
2023-05-25
h5打包的app怎么调微信登录
首先,需要了解一下h5打包的app和微信登录的基本概念。H5打包的app是将网页和web应用程序包装成独立的应用程序,可以在移动设备上运行。微信登录是指用户通过使用微信账号登录第三方应用程序或网站的一种快捷方式。在H5打包的app中调用微信登录的基本流程如
2023-05-25
h5 app接口开发
H5 App是基于HTML5技术实现的web应用程序,它通过浏览器渲染HTML、CSS和JavaScript等前端技术来实现应用程序的运行。而H5 App接口开发则是H5 App构建的一项关键技术,其作用就是实现前端H5应用程序与后台服务器的数据交互和通信
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3